SwiftUIGPT-Бесплатный помощник-эксперт по SwiftUI

Революционизируем разработку SwiftUI с помощью ИИ

Home > GPTs > SwiftUIGPT
Получить код вставки
YesChatSwiftUIGPT

How do I implement a custom view modifier in SwiftUI?

Can you provide an example of using Combine with SwiftUI?

What are the best practices for optimizing performance in a SwiftUI app?

How can I create complex animations using SwiftUI?

Оцените этот инструмент

20.0 / 5 (200 votes)

Обзор SwiftUIGPT

SwiftUIGPT - это специализированный ИИ-инструмент, предназначенный для оказания углубленной помощи в работе с SwiftUI, современным инструментарием пользовательского интерфейса, представленным Apple для разработки приложений iOS и macOS. Он использует обширную базу знаний, включающую официальную документацию Apple и различные проектно-ориентированные ресурсы, чтобы предложить точное и актуальное руководство. Основное назначение SwiftUIGPT - помочь разработчикам ориентироваться в тонкостях SwiftUI, от базовых концепций до продвинутых реализаций. Он предлагает идеи по кодированию, стратегии решения проблем и методы настройки для повышения эффективности и результативности разработки приложений. Powered by ChatGPT-4o

Основные функции SwiftUIGPT

  • Предоставление примеров кода

    Example Example

    Если пользователь испытывает трудности с созданием динамического списка в SwiftUI, SwiftUIGPT может предоставить подробный пример кода, демонстрирующий, как реализовать представление List, привязать его к модели данных и обрабатывать взаимодействия пользователя.

    Example Scenario

    Разработчик создает приложение со списком дел и нуждается в помощи с реализацией представления списка.

  • Стратегии решения проблем

    Example Example

    Для распространенной проблемы, такой как управление состоянием в SwiftUI, SwiftUIGPT может очертить различные стратегии, такие как использование @State, @ObservableObject или @EnvironmentObject, предоставляя фрагменты кода и объясняя, когда каждый подход наиболее подходит.

    Example Scenario

    Приложение требует сложного решения управления состоянием для синхронизации пользовательского интерфейса с базовыми изменениями данных.

  • Рекомендации для конкретного проекта

    Example Example

    В проекте, связанном с анимацией, SwiftUIGPT может посоветовать по реализации и оптимизации анимации в SwiftUI, предлагая примеры из своего источника знаний, такие как анимация переворота карточки или плавный эффект перехода.

    Example Scenario

    Разработчик улучшает пользовательский интерфейс интерактивной анимацией, но сталкивается с проблемами производительности.

Целевые группы пользователей SwiftUIGPT

  • Разработчики для iOS и macOS

    Это профессионалы или любители, разрабатывающие приложения для платформ Apple. Они извлекают пользу из всесторонних знаний SwiftUIGPT о SwiftUI, что помогает им создавать более эффективные, отзывчивые и визуально привлекательные приложения.

  • Дизайнеры пользовательского интерфейса/опыта

    Дизайнеры, сосредоточенные на создании интуитивно понятных и привлекательных пользовательских интерфейсов для приложений iOS и macOS, могут использовать SwiftUIGPT, чтобы понять технические возможности и ограничения SwiftUI, помогая проектировать осуществимые и инновационные концепции пользовательского интерфейса.

  • Преподаватели и студенты

    Преподаватели, обучающие разработке приложений, и студенты, изучающие SwiftUI, могут использовать SwiftUIGPT в качестве образовательного ресурса, получая представление о лучших практиках, стандартах кодирования и последних функциях SwiftUI.

Рекомендации по использованию SwiftUIGPT

  • 1

    Посетите yeschat.ai для бесплатной пробной версии без необходимости входа или подписки на ChatGPT Plus.

  • 2

    Выберите «SwiftUIGPT» из доступных вариантов инструментов, чтобы сфокусироваться на конкретных запросах SwiftUI.

  • 3

    Подготовьте свои вопросы, связанные с SwiftUI, или фрагменты кода для запроса, убедившись, что они конкретно относятся к вашим потребностям в разработке.

  • 4

    Взаимодействуйте с SwiftUIGPT, задавая вопросы или запрашивая советы по разработке SwiftUI, и изучайте адаптированные ответы.

  • 5

    Используйте предложенные примеры кода и стратегии решения проблем в разработке вашего приложения iOS или macOS для практического применения.

Часто задаваемые вопросы о SwiftUIGPT

  • Чем SwiftUIGPT отличается от других ИИ-моделей?

    SwiftUIGPT специализируется на SwiftUI, предоставляя углубленную помощь для разработки приложений iOS и macOS с использованием SwiftUI, с акцентом на реальное применение и решение конкретных проблем.

  • Может ли SwiftUIGPT помочь в отладке кода SwiftUI?

    Да, SwiftUIGPT может помочь в выявлении проблем в вашем коде SwiftUI и предложить исправления или оптимизации.

  • Как максимально использовать SwiftUIGPT в моем проекте?

    Чтобы максимально использовать потенциал SwiftUIGPT, задавайте четкие, конкретные вопросы или примеры кода, относящиеся к вашему проекту SwiftUI. Это позволит получить более точные и применимые советы.

  • Подходит ли SwiftUIGPT для начинающих в SwiftUI?

    Безусловно, SwiftUIGPT разработан для обслуживания как начинающих, так и опытных разработчиков, предлагая рекомендации от базовых концепций до продвинутых методик в SwiftUI.

  • Может ли SwiftUIGPT предоставлять обновленную информацию на основе последней версии SwiftUI?

    SwiftUIGPT идет в ногу с последними обновлениями и функциями SwiftUI, гарантируя, что предоставляемые советы и решения соответствуют последней официальной документации Apple.